The cheapest way to get from AG – DMS Station to The New College is to bus which costs ₹7 - ₹25 and takes 19 min.
The fastest way to get from AG – DMS Station to The New College is to taxi which takes 3 min and costs ₹170 - ₹210.
Yes, there is a direct bus departing from Anna Salai Vanavil and arriving at Anand Theatre. Services depart every four hours, and operate every day. The journey takes approximately 7 min.
Yes, there is a direct train departing from Ag-Dms and arriving at Thousand Lights. Services depart every 10 minutes, and operate every day. The journey takes approximately 3 min.
The distance between AG – DMS Station and The New College is 3 km.
The best way to get from AG – DMS Station to The New College without a car is to subway which takes 11 min and costs ₹19 - ₹23.
The subway from Ag-Dms to Thousand Lights takes 3 min including transfers and departs every 10 minutes.
AG – DMS Station to The New College bus services, operated by MTC, depart from Anna Salai Vanavil station.
AG – DMS Station to The New College train services, operated by Chennai Metro Rail Limited, depart from Ag-Dms station.
AG – DMS Station to The New College bus services, operated by MTC, arrive at Anand Theatre station.
What companies run services between AG – DMS Station, India and The New College, India?
Chennai Metro Rail Limited operates a subway from Ag-Dms to Thousand Lights every 10 minutes. Tickets cost ₹19–23 and the journey takes 3 min. Alternatively, MTC operates a bus from Anna Salai Vanavil to Anand Theatre every 4 hours. Tickets cost ₹7–25 and the journey takes 7 min.
